Mercedes-AMG is embarking on the new roadster season in inimitably  dynamic style: following on from the launch of the SL63 AMG, the  top eight-cylinder model, there now comes the presentation of the new  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G, the V12 roadster in the line-up from the  Stuttgart-based manufacturer. The AMG 6.0-litre V12 "biturbo"  (twin-turbocharged) engine develops a maximum output of 463 kW (630 hp)  and maximum torque of 1000 newton metres. The result: exceptional  performance, impressive power delivery and effortlessly superior  dynamics. As with the SLS AMG super  sports car, the use of an all-aluminium bodyshell results in a drastic  reduction in weight. The new SL65 AMG is some 170 kilograms lighter than  before. The expressive front section is dominated by the new "twin  blade" radiator grille and the front apron's lower cross strut in  high-sheen chrome.
"The combination of exclusive V12 dynamic  performance and a refined roadster driving experience was already the  defining attribute of the predecessor  model. We are convinced that, with the new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G, we  have developed an incomparably exciting high-performance vehicle for the  small, but loyal community of fans", says Ola Källenius, CEO of  Mercedes-AMG GmbH.
An important aspect of the new model is the intelligent lightweight  construction which also contributes to reducing the fuel consumption. At  11.6 litres per 100 kilometres (NEDC combined) it represents a saving  of 2.4 litres or 17 percent compared with the previous SL65 AMG and  simultaneously establishes a new benchmark in the twelve-cylinder petrol  engine segment. A major role in the reduced fuel consumption figures is  played by the AMG SPEEDSHIFT PLUS 7G-TRONIC transmission, the ECO  start/stop‑function, in-engine measures to optimise efficiency and  alternator management. Despite the significantly reduced fuel  consumption, the maximum output of the AMG V12 6-litre biturbo engine is  up from 450 kW (612 hp) to 463 kW (630 hp). The maximum torque is 1000  newton metres.
The unrivalled performance figures of the new  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G translate into an exceptional driving experience:  ac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h takes 4 seconds with the 200 km/h mark  attained after just 11.8 seconds. The top speed is 250 km/h  (electronically limited). As well as offering stunning acceleration, the  AMG twelve-cylinder biturbo engine impresses with its smooth running  characteristics and its distinctive AMG V12 sound. It is a performance  that reconciles effortless superiority and stylishness to perfection.
AMG  6-litre V12 biturbo engine with new technology
The AMG  6-litre V12 biturbo engine with the designation M 279 is based on the M  275 engine used previously and has been comprehensively revised for the  new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G. New exhaust gas turbochargers with an  increased spiral cross-section, new manifolds and wastegate ducts with  optimised flow characteristics increase the engine output by 13 kW (18  hp). The multi-spark ignition with twelve double ignition coils not only  results in smoother running, but also enables even more effective  combustion in combination with a new engine management system with  higher performance and optimised cylinder heads. The resulting reduction  in exhaust emissions is also due to a large extent to the optimised  catalytic converter system. The newly developed AMG sports exhaust  system, which has a pipe layout with enhanced flow characteristics, is  3.2 kilograms lighter as a result of a reduction in the wall thickness.
But  it is not just the inner qualities of the AMG 6-litre V12 biturbo  engine that impress. The powerplant's looks are as inspiring as its  performance: the high-quality carbon-fibre and aluminium engine cover  reflects the exceptional character of the powerful twelve-cylinder unit.
New:  AMG SPEEDSHIFT PLUS 7G-TRONIC
For the first time AMG has  combined the 6-litre V12 biturbo engine with the AMG SPEEDSHIFT PLUS  7G‑TRONIC. The seven-speed automatic transmission with its wide gear  ratio spread enables a significantly lower engine speed and helps to  reduce fuel consumption. A new fuel economy torque converter, bearings  designed for reduced friction loss and the transmission-oil thermal  management system are responsible for a further increase in the  efficiency of the power transmission system.
The AMG SPEEDSHIFT  PLUS 7G‑TRONIC has four different driving modes - Controlled Efficiency  (C), Sport (S), Sport plus (S+) and Manual (M) - which can be selected  at the push of a button on the centre console. In "C" mode the ECO  start/stop function is permanently active. The compelling, dynamic  character of the driving experience is made all the more vivid by the  automatic double-declutching function during downshifts and through the  brief, precisely defined interruption of ignition and fuel injection  during upshifts under full load; the latter functionality has the  additional benefit of reducing the shift times.
Intelligent  lightweight construction with all-aluminium bodyshell and carbon fibre
Compared  with the predecessor model's steel design, the all-aluminium bodyshell  of the new SL65 AMG delivers a significant weight saving of around 110  kilograms as well as superior rigidity, safety and comfort. Intelligent  lightweight construction also means that the components have been  optimised in line with their specific purpose. Various types of  processing are used for the aluminium components, for instance, which  are produced as permanent mould castings or vacuum die castings before  being processed into extruded sections or used in the form of sheet  aluminium with varying wall thicknesses. The result is high rigidity,  high safety and improved vibration characteristics. For the cover behind  the tank, the designers use even lighter magnesium material in certain  areas. High-strength steel tubes are integrated into the A-pillars for  safety reasons.
The boot lid helps to further trim the weight. For  the first time on a volume-produced model, the inner support is made  from lightweight carbon-fibre composite. The extremely rigid  carbon-fibre component is bonded to the plastic outer shell, resulting  in a weight saving of five kilograms compared with a conventional boot  lid - an innovative solution that is being pioneered with the AMG SL  models. This raft of innovative lightweight-design measures means that,  at an EC kerb weight of 1950 kilograms, the new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G  is 170 kilograms lighter than the model it replaces.
AMG  sports suspension based on Active Body Control
Mercedes-AMG  also makes systematic use of lightweight construction principles for  the suspension. The steering knuckles and spring links of the 4-link  front suspension and almost all of the multi-link independent rear  suspension components are made of aluminium. Both the vehicle's handling  agility and the response of the spring and damper components are  enhanced by the reduction in unsprung masses. Like the predecessor  model, the new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G is equipped as standard with the  ABC active suspension system. The AMG sports suspension based on Active  Body Control fitted in the eight-cylinder SL63 AMG has been enhanced and  its setup optimised for this new top-of-the-range model.
Driving  dynamics and performance were the key objectives during the design,  development and testing phases. It is possible to choose between two  suspension settings at the touch of a button: distinctly sporty  characteristics with reduced roll angles and firm body damping ("Sport")  or a mode for high comfort on long journeys ("Comfort"). More negative  camber on both axles and fully revised elastokinematics result in  greater agility and faster cornering speeds.
New  electromechanical AMG speed-sensitive sports steering
Equipped  with the newly developed electro-mechanical AMG speed-sensitive sports  steering, the V12 top model impresses with high dynamic qualities and  eloquent feedback at the critical limits. The steering has a constant,  more direct ratio and variable power assistance which adjusts in line  with the suspension mode. Further standard equipment includes 3-stage  ESP®, a speciality exclusive to AMG with "SPORT Handling" mode for  particularly keen drivers, and an AMG rear axle differential which helps  ensure that the phenomenal engine output is put down on the road as  effectively as possible.
All the qualities expected of an AMG  high-performance braking system - excellent deceleration  characteristics, optimum sensitivity and high resistance to fading - are  delivered to perfection by the newly developed brake system of the SL65  AMG. It features 390 x 36 mm compound discs with six-piston fixed  callipers at the front and 360 x 26 mm integral discs with single-piston  sliding callipers at the rear. An electric parking brake is fitted as  standard. Red-painted callipers, as well as the even more powerful  weight-optimised AMG ceramic high-performance compound brake system as  seen on the SLS AMG, are available from the AMG Performance Studio as  options.
New AMG brand face with two blade-like louvres
The  new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G lives up to its stylish and exclusive  high-performance roadster claim not only with its engineering but  through its looks, too. The SL65 AMG is the first model to feature the  new AMG brand face. The two elements which dominate the form - the  radiator grille and the lower cooling air intake - are retained but in  reinterpreted form which gives them a more distinctive identity in terms  of dynamism and the sense of perceived value they convey. The central  styling feature is the new "twin blade" radiator grille in high-sheen  chrome. The Mercedes star is mounted on two blade-like louvres whose  profile recalls that of an aircraft wing. The more pronounced V-shape of  the radiator grille optimises the longitudinal proportions of the  vehicle and so adds even greater visual emphasis to the attributes of  aerodynamics and purism.
Below the "twin blade" radiator grille,  the stylised "A", a characteristic feature of AMG vehicles, is retained.  A gap formed below a fine black fin at the lower edge of the cooling  air opening allows an optimum airflow over the cooling modules - a  perfect combination of aesthetics and high technology. The lower cross  strut in the front apron is finished in high-sheen chrome and is given a  perceived sense of depth by the gap above it - a distinctive note which  adds the perfect finishing touch to the front of the vehicle. The "twin  blade" radiator grille and lower cross strut are the two complementary  styling elements which underline the new AMG brand face - a look which  will be picked up by the styling of future AMG models and so further  increase the recognition value of the AMG performance brand.
The  V12 top model is distinguished from the SL63 AMG through the strategic  use of high-sheen chrome highlights: along with the "twin blade"  radiator grille and the lower cross strut, the surrounds of the special  AMG daytime running lamps as well as the fins on the bonnet and the side  of the wings have the same finish. Further characteristic AMG styling  cues to be found on the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G include the front apron  with large openings for the engine oil, water, charge air and  transmission oil coolers, the specially shaped side sill panels, the AMG  spoiler lip and the diffuser-look rear apron with a vehicle-colour  insert.
In addition to the two special chromed twin tailpipes of  the AMG sports exhaust system, the characteristic V12 features include  the "V12 BITURBO" legend on the front wings and the AMG 5-spoke  light-alloy wheels painted in titanium grey with a high-sheen finish and  equipped with 255/35 R 19 and 285/30 R 19 tyres at front and rear  respectively. AMG multi-spoke forged light-alloy wheels from the AMG  Performance Studio with 255/35 R 19 front tyres and 285/30 R 20 rear  tyres reduce the unsprung masses. The forged wheels are also available  in matt black with a high-sheen rim flange.
Vario-roof:  MAGIC SKY CONTROL as an option
The sixth-generation SL  retains the electrohydraulically operated vario-roof which can be  retracted to save space, enabling the SL65 AMG to be transformed into a  roadster or a coupé, as the mood takes the driver and depending on the  weather, in under 20 seconds. In contrast to the predecessor model,  there are two versions to choose from for the new SL: the panoramic  vario-roof or the unique panoramic vario-roof with MAGIC SKY CONTROL.  The transparency of the latter can be switched to light or dark at the  push of a button.
Interior: a feast for all the senses
Inside,  too, the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G has exclusive design and equipment  features which differentiate it from its eight-cylinder sister model.  The electrically adjustable AMG sports seats with single or two-tone  upholstery in Exclusive nappa leather with a special AMG diamond pattern  are a particular highlight. This distinctive upholstery is also to be  found on the door centre panels. Embossed AMG emblems on the seat  backrests are standard, as are AIRSCARF neck-level heating, multicontour  functionality, seat memory and climatised seats. The designo headlining  in leather with partial AMG V12 diamond-design quilting provides the  perfect visual and tactile finishing touch.
The design of the  cockpit recalls the SLS AMG: the four air vents styled like jet engines,  the E-SELECT lever and the AMG DRIVE UNIT are all reminiscent of the  super sports car's styling. The choice of exquisite materials and the  first-class workmanship which characterise the interior of the SL65 AMG  indulge all the senses. Highlights include the AMG carbon-fibre trim  elements, the IWC-design analogue clock, the chromed AMG door sill  panels illuminated in white and the AMG Performance steering wheel which  is embellished by an AMG logo in the lower metal insert. A speedometer  calibrated to 360 km/h in the AMG instrument cluster and the AMG  start-up display with an exclusive AMG V12 BITURBO animation hint at the  exceptionally dynamic performance of the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G.

One of the world's safest roadsters
A  crash-optimised aluminium structure, standard-fit PRE-SAFE® system and  assistance systems on a par with those of the S-Class make the SL one of  the world's safest roadsters. The rigid aluminium bodyshell forms a  robust occupant compartment as well as precisely defined deformation  zones at the front and rear. If the vehicle rolls over, A-pillars made  from a steel-aluminium material mix and two automatic roll-over bars  help to protect the occupants.
The restraint systems, including  two-stage driver and passenger airbags, have been further enhanced. A  headbag covers much of the side head-impact area. An additional thorax  airbag in the backrest can protect the upper body in the event of a side  impact. Further new standard features for the SL include the  Mercedes-Benz-developed NECK-PRO crash-responsive head restraints. An  active bonnet and a front end with a large, yielding impact area help  ensure pedestrian protection.
The market launch of the new  Mercedes-Benz SL65 AMG will take place in September 2012. The sales  price in Germany (incl. 19% VAT) is 236,334 euros.
